Abstract

The utility model provides a keyboard leather sheath. The keyboard leather sheath comprises: the cover plate, the bottom plate, the support plate, the first bending part, the second bending part and the third bending part; the cover plate is connected with the bottom plate through a first bending part, the middle part of the cover plate is provided with an opening, the support plate is embedded in the opening, the top edge of the support plate is connected with the top edge of the opening through a second bending part, the bottom edge of the support plate is connected with the bottom edge of the opening through a third bending part, and separating grooves are respectively arranged between the left side edge and the right side edge of the support plate and the left side edge and the right side edge of the opening; the cover plate includes: the first sub-board, the fourth bending part and the second sub-board are connected in sequence; the support plate includes: the third sub-board, the fifth bending part, the fourth sub-board, the sixth bending part and the fifth sub-board are connected in sequence; the fourth bending part and the sixth bending part are positioned on the same straight line, and multi-angle support can be realized by adjusting the folding direction of the supporting plate.

Keyboard leather sheath
Technical Field
The utility model relates to an electronic product technical field especially relates to a keyboard leather sheath.
Background
With the rapid popularization of tablet computers of apple, companies are all accelerating the market layout of tablet computers. PC manufacturers, mobile phone manufacturers, chip manufacturers, household appliance manufacturers, digital manufacturers and the like are involved in the new market, and tablet personal computer products are successively released.
Tablet computers are similar in appearance to laptops, but rather than being purely laptops, they may be referred to as condensed versions of laptops. The appearance of the portable computer is between that of a notebook computer and a palm computer, but the processing capacity of the portable computer is larger than that of the palm computer, and compared with the notebook computer, the portable computer has all functions, also supports handwriting input or voice input, and has better mobility and portability.
The tablet personal computer comprises various devices such as a display screen and the like which are easy to damage due to external impact, a user often equips the tablet personal computer with a protective sleeve in order to protect the tablet personal computer and prolong the service life of the tablet personal computer, and the protective sleeve can protect the tablet personal computer and can change the tablet personal computer into a notebook computer for use.
Meanwhile, the tablet personal computer is not provided with a keyboard for improving portability, is not suitable for a person skilled in using the keyboard for inputting, and cannot perform the touch input operation of the computer skillfully. Therefore, a lot of tablet personal computers with keyboards (also called keyboard leather covers) appear in the market, which not only can provide the keyboard for the tablet personal computers, but also can support the tablet personal computers on the desktop, and can also protect the tablet personal computers from being damaged. The existing keyboard leather sheath generally has an expansion state and a folding state, in the expansion state, a keyboard is fixed on a bottom plate of the keyboard leather sheath, a tablet personal computer is fixed on a cover plate of the keyboard leather sheath, a supporting angle is formed between the bottom plate and the cover plate, in the folding state, the bottom plate and the cover plate are stacked, and the tablet personal computer and the keyboard are accommodated between the bottom plate and the cover plate.

Detailed Description
To further illustrate the technical means and effects of the present invention, the following detailed description is given with reference to the preferred embodiments of the present invention and the accompanying drawings.
Referring to fig. 1 to 7, the present invention provides a keyboard leather sheath, including: the structure comprises a cover plate 1, a bottom plate 2, a support plate 3, a first bent part 4, a second bent part 5 and a third bent part 6;
the cover plate 1 is connected with the bottom plate 2 through a first bent part 4, an opening 101 is formed in the middle of the cover plate 1, the support plate 3 is embedded in the opening 101, the top edge of the support plate 3 is connected with the top edge of the opening 101 through a second bent part 5, the bottom edge of the support plate 3 is connected with the bottom edge of the opening 101 through a third bent part 6, and separation grooves 301 are respectively formed between the left side edge of the support plate 3 and the left side edge of the opening 101 and between the right side edge of the support plate 3 and the right side edge of the opening 101;
the cover plate 1 includes: a first sub-board 11, a fourth bending part 12 and a second sub-board 13 which are connected in sequence; the support plate 3 includes: a third sub-board 31, a fifth bent portion 32, a fourth sub-board 33, a sixth bent portion 34, and a fifth sub-board 35 connected in this order;
the top edge and the bottom edge of the supporting plate 3 are respectively a side edge of the third sub-plate 31 far away from the fifth bending portion 32 and a side edge of the fifth sub-plate 35 far away from the sixth bending portion 34, and the fourth bending portion 12 and the sixth bending portion 34 are located on the same straight line.
Specifically, the shape of the support plate 3 is matched with that of the opening 101, preferably, the shape of the support plate 3 is trapezoidal with that of the opening 101, and the left side and the right side of the support plate 3 are the waist of the trapezoidal.
Specifically, referring to fig. 1, the keyboard leather case further includes: a first suction device 71 provided in the third sub-board 31, a second suction device 72 provided in the first sub-board 11, a third suction device 73 provided in the fourth sub-board 33, and a fourth suction device 74 provided in the first sub-board 11 and located on a side of the second suction device 72 away from the third sub-board 31.
Further, as the second bent portion 5 is bent in a direction approaching the outer surface of the first sub-board 11, the third sub-board 31 and the fourth sub-board 33 can be stacked on the outer surface of the first sub-board 11, and the first suction device 71 and the second suction device 72 are adapted to be sucked together, and the third suction device 73 and the fourth suction device 74 are adapted to be sucked together.
Further, as the second bent portion 5 is bent in a direction close to the inner surface of the first sub-board 11 and the fifth bent portion 32 is bent in a direction close to the outer surface of the third sub-board 31, the third sub-board 31 can be laminated on the inner surface of the first sub-board 11, the fourth sub-board 33 can be laminated on the outer surface of the third sub-board 31, and the first suction device 71 can be simultaneously sucked to the second suction device 72 and the third suction device 73.
Specifically, referring to fig. 1, the keyboard leather case further includes: a cover head 8 and a seventh bending part 9 are folded;
the folding cover head 8 is connected with one side of the bottom plate 2 far away from the cover plate 1 through a seventh bending part 9.
Specifically, referring to fig. 1 and 2, the keyboard leather case further includes: a fifth adsorption device 75 disposed in the folding cover head 8, and a sixth adsorption device 76 disposed in the bottom plate 2 and corresponding to the fifth adsorption device 75; with reference to fig. 3 and 4, as the seventh bending portion 9 is bent toward the inner surface of the bottom plate 2, the foldable lid 8 can be stacked on the inner surface of the bottom plate 2, and the fifth suction device 75 and the sixth suction device 76 can be sucked together.
Further, a flexible filler is arranged inside the folding cover head 8.
Preferably, the flexible filler is a memory sponge.
Generally, referring to fig. 7, in order to facilitate bending, the thicknesses of the first bending portion 4, the second bending portion 5, the third bending portion 6, the fourth bending portion 12, the fifth bending portion 32, the sixth bending portion 34 and the seventh bending portion 9 are smaller than the thicknesses of other areas of the keyboard leather sheath.
Specifically, referring to fig. 2 to 4, the keyboard leather case further includes: the tablet protection shell 100 is used for accommodating a tablet computer, and the tablet protection shell 100 is connected with the second sub-board 13.
Preferably, the protective flat panel case 100 is bonded to the inner surface of the second sub-panel 13.
Specifically, referring to fig. 2 to 4, the keyboard leather case further includes a keyboard K disposed on the inner surface of the bottom plate 2.
Specifically, referring to fig. 2 to 4, the keyboard holster further includes a touch pad T disposed on the inner surface of the bottom plate 2, and the touch pad T is located on a side of the keyboard K away from the cover plate 1.
Preferably, the keyboard K and the touch pad T are arranged in the bottom plate 2 in an undetachable manner, and the keyboard K and the touch pad T are of an integrated structure and can be in communication connection with a tablet personal computer through Bluetooth.
Preferably, the first adsorption device 71, the second adsorption device 72, the third adsorption device 73, the fourth adsorption device 74, the fifth adsorption device 75 and the sixth adsorption device 76 are all magnets.
Preferably, the number of the first suction devices 71, the second suction devices 72, the third suction devices 73 and the fourth suction devices 74 is two, the two first suction devices 71 are respectively arranged at two ends of the third sub-board 31, the two third suction devices 73 are respectively arranged at two ends of the fourth sub-board 33, the two second suction devices 72 are arranged at intervals, and the two fourth suction devices 74 are arranged at intervals and are positioned at one side of the second suction device 72 far away from the third sub-board 31.
Further, the two first suction devices 71 and the two fourth suction devices 74 have N-polarity at the ends thereof located on the inner surface when the keyboard leather sheath is unfolded, and the two second suction devices 72 and the two third suction devices 73 have S-polarity at the ends thereof located on the inner surface when the keyboard leather sheath is unfolded.
Preferably, the number of the fifth adsorption devices 75 and the number of the sixth adsorption devices 76 are five, the fifth adsorption devices 75 are sequentially arranged along the length direction of the closing and collecting cover head 8, and the five sixth adsorption devices 76 are arranged at intervals on one side of the bottom plate 2 close to the seventh bending portion 9 and are in one-to-one correspondence with the five fifth adsorption devices 75.
It should be noted that, with reference to fig. 1 and 7, positions of two fifth adsorption devices 75 (two rectangular fifth adsorption devices 75 in fig. 1) of the five fifth adsorption devices 75 also correspond to positions of the two second adsorption devices 72, when the keyboard holster is folded, the folding cover head 8 can be folded to the outer surface of the cover plate 1 through the seventh bending portion 9, and the two fifth adsorption devices 75 are correspondingly adsorbed to the two second adsorption devices 72.
Preferably, the ends of the five fifth suction devices 75, which are located at the inner surface when the keyboard leather case is unfolded, are all N-polarity, and the ends of the five sixth suction devices 76, which are located at the inner surface when the keyboard leather case is unfolded, are all S-polarity.
When the foldable keyboard is used, firstly, the tablet personal computer is installed in the tablet protective shell 100, then, as shown in fig. 4, the seventh bending part 9 is bent towards the direction close to the inner surface of the bottom plate 2, so that the foldable cover head 8 is stacked on the inner surface of the bottom plate 2, the five fifth adsorption devices 75 and the five sixth adsorption devices 76 adsorb each other respectively, at this time, the foldable cover head 8 can be used as a keyboard handrail, and the wrist of a user is lapped on the foldable cover head 8 provided with the flexible filler, so that friction can be effectively reduced, hand fatigue can be relieved, and the comfort of the wrist of the user can be enhanced.
Then, a support angle of the tablet computer is selected according to needs, and the support angle specifically includes two types:
the first support angle is realized as follows: as shown in fig. 5, first, the fourth bent portion 12 and the third bent portion 6 are bent in a direction away from the tablet protective case 100, the second bent portion 5 is bent in a direction close to the outer surface of the first sub-board 11, the fifth bent portion 32 is not bent, the sixth bent portion 34 is bent in a direction close to the inner surface of the fourth sub-board 33, so that the third sub-board 31 and the fourth sub-board 33 are respectively stacked on the outer surface of the first sub-board 11, the fifth sub-board 35 is supported between the first sub-board 11 and the second sub-board 13, the first adsorption device 71 and the second adsorption device 72 are correspondingly adsorbed, and the third adsorption device 73 and the fourth adsorption device 74 are correspondingly adsorbed.
The second support angle is implemented as follows: as shown in fig. 6, first, the fourth bent portion 12 and the third bent portion 6 are bent in a direction away from the tablet protective case 100, the second bent portion 5 is bent in a direction close to the inner surface of the first sub-board 11, the fifth bent portion 32 is bent in a direction close to the outer surface of the third sub-board 31, the sixth bent portion 34 is bent in a direction away from the inner surface of the fourth sub-board 33, so that the third sub-board 31 is stacked on the inner surface of the first sub-board 11, the fourth sub-board 33 is stacked on the outer surface of the third sub-board 31, the fifth sub-board 35 is supported between the first sub-board 11 and the second sub-board 13, and the first adsorption device 71, the second adsorption device 72 and the third adsorption device 73 are adsorbed to each other.
Finally, as shown in fig. 1 and 7, when the keyboard holster is folded, the cover plate 1 is stacked on the bottom plate 2 through the first bending portion 4, the folded cover head 8 is stacked on the outer surface of the cover plate 1 through the seventh bending portion 9, and the two fifth suction devices 75 are correspondingly sucked with the two second suction devices 72, so that the folded cover head 8 is fixed on the outer surface of the cover plate 1.
Thus, the utility model discloses a keyboard leather sheath can provide the stable support of the angle of two kinds of differences and have the receipts that can act as the keyboard handrail and close the caping, and it is nimble convenient to use, and user experience is higher.
